Cashback Credit Cards
Cashback credit cards are an excellent option for those looking to earn rewards on their purchases. With a credit score of 730, you are likely to be eligible for some of the bestcashback credit cardson the market. One such card is the Chase Freedom Unlimited card, which offers a flat 1.5% cashback on all purchases. Another great option is the Citi Double Cash card, which offers 1% cashback on all purchases and an additional 1% cashback when you pay off your balance. These cards are great for those who want to earn rewards on everyday purchases and can pay off their balance in full each month.
Travel Rewards Credit Cards
If you love to travel, then a travel rewards credit card may be the perfect fit for you. With a credit score of 730, you are likely to be eligible for some of the toptravel rewards credit cardsavailable. One such card is the Chase Sapphire Preferred card, which offers 2x points on travel and dining purchases and 1x points on all other purchases. Another great option is the Capital One Venture Rewards card, which offers 2x miles on all purchases. These cards are great for those who travel frequently and want to earn rewards that can be redeemed for flights, hotels, and other travel expenses.
Balance Transfer Credit Cards
If you are carrying a balance on a high-interest credit card, a balance transfer credit card can help you save money on interest charges. With a credit score of 730, you are likely to be eligible for some of the bestbalance transfer credit cardsavailable. One such card is the Citi Simplicity card, which offers a 0% APR on balance transfers for 21 months. Another great option is the Discover it Balance Transfer card, which offers a 0% APR on balance transfers for 18 months and 5% cashback on rotating categories. These cards are great for those who want to save money on interest charges and pay off their balance faster.
Tips for Applying for Credit Cards
When applying for credit cards, there are a few things to keep in mind to increase your chances of approval and avoid any potential issues. Firstly, make sure to check your credit score and report to ensure there are no errors or discrepancies. Secondly, only apply for credit cards that you are likely to be approved for based on your credit score and income. Finally, be sure to read the terms and conditions of any credit card carefully, including any fees, interest rates, and rewards programs.

Avoiding Fees and Risks
While credit cards can be a great tool for earning rewards and saving money, they can also come with fees and risks. One such fee is the annual fee, which some credit cards charge each year. It is important to weigh the benefits of a credit card against any annual fee or other fees that may be charged. It is also important to protect yourself against fraud and identity theft by monitoring your credit card statements regularly and reporting any suspicious activity to your credit card company immediately.
